ROUTE SCREEN
WARNING!
Always stop the vehicle in a safe location
before modifying the route conditions.
Modifying the route conditions while driving
may cause an accident.
During route guidance, the route condi-
tions can be modified and the route
information can be confirmed. Set route
conditions according to personal prefer-
ence.
BASIC OPERATION
1. Push.
2. Highlight the preferred setting item and push .
3. Push to return to the current
location map screen.
Available setting items . [Cancel Route/Resume Route]:
Cancels the current route guidance. A
canceled route can also be reactivated.
If the suggested route is canceled,
[Cancel Route] changes to [Resume
Route].
“Canceling/reactivating route”
(page 5-14)
. [Edit/Add to Route]:
Edit or add a destination or waypoints
to the route that is already set.
“Editing route” (page 5-15)
. [Route Info]:
Confirm the route by the route informa-
tion or simulation. The confirmed route
can also be stored.
“Confirming route” (page 5-20)
. [Guidance Settings]:
Activates or deactivates route, voice guidance and/or traffic announcement
and adjust the volume level of voice
guidance.
“Guidance settings”
(page 5-21)
. [Recalculate]:
Manually search for the route again
after changing the search condition and
have the system calculate a route.
“Recalculate route” (page 5-22)
. [Detour]:
A detour of a specified distance can be
calculated.
“Setting detour route” (page 5-23)
. [Traffic Detour]:
Manually search for an alternative
detour route taking the traffic informa-
tion into consideration.
“Searching for detour route taking
traffic information into considera-
tion” (page 5-24)
. [Route Settings]:
Changes the route calculation condi-
tions anywhere along the route.
“Setting conditions for route cal-
culation” (page 5-25)

Changing route calculation condi-
tions
Each section of the route between way-
points can have different route calculation
conditions. After setting these conditions,
the entire route can be recalculated.
1. Push.
2. Highlight [Edit/Add to Route] and push .
3. Highlight the preferred section of the route to the destination or waypoint
and push .
4. Highlight the preferred condition and
push .
Available conditions
: [Fastest Route]
: [Minimize Freeway]
: [Shortest Route]
5. The conditions have been changed and the display returns to the [Edit Route]
screen.
6. By highlighting [Calculate] and pushing, the system will recalculate the
routes. After the route search is com-
pleted, the display will automatically
return to the current location map
screen.
INFO:
.
The recalculated route may not be the
shortest route because the system priori-
tizes roads that are easy to drive for safety
reasons.
.If the route conditions are set from [Route
Settings], all sections in the route are
subject to the same route conditions. This
applies even if different route conditions
have been set for different sections in [Edit
Route].

SEARCHING FOR DETOUR ROUTE
TAKING TRAFFIC INFORMATION INTO
CONSIDERATION
When a serious traffic event occurs on the
route, or if the system finds a faster route,
a detour alert will pop up automatically. If
the automatic alert is not noticed, a detour
can also be manually searched.
1. Push.
2. Highlight [Traffic Detour] and push
.
3. When the detour search is successful,detailed information about the detour
route (left screen) and the comparison
screen of the two routes (right screen)
are displayed.
*1Original route (yellow)
*2Detour route (pink)
*3The change of distance and esti-
mated travel time to destination
when the detour route is taken.
4. To accept the suggested detour route, highlight [Yes], and then push .
INFO:
.
If no route is set, or [Use Real Time Traffic
Information] is turned off, this function
cannot be operated.
.If a detour route is not selected and no
further action is performed, the detour route
will be automatically canceled.
.The detour suggestion can be retrieved even
after the message disappears by manually
selecting [Traffic Detour]. The system will
then search for the detour again and
suggests a detour if one is available at that
time.
.Without a subscription to a NavTraffic
broadcast, it will not be possible to get a
traffic detour or apply settings for functions
related to traffic information. A message
appears when a related menu item is
selected.
